One common tip for improving traffic to your website is to post more often. After all, if you post once a week, your readers will figure that out and come back once a week - so if you post twice a week, they should figure that out too and come back twice as much. But it can take a lot of thought and effort to post a lot on a website.

How often do you update your site?
Does it matter what type of site you are updating? In other words, would you update a site about crafts more or less often than a site about news? What about sites with products for sale? In answering this poll, just try to think generally, and if it depends greatly on the type of site, let us know in the comments.

Personally, I try to update this site every day. I am not as good at regular updates to my other sites. I update a photoblog daily but otherwise, I probably update the sites I manage around once a month. When I say update, I mean making a change to the home page or some other significant portion of the site.

My blog: once a week. I had settled at once a month before, but I found out that if I update my blog twice more often than before, the number of regular visitors does much more than doubling, so that motivates me to keep up the pace.

My professional website: not enough! about once a year, when I decide to redesign it from scratch again…

I update quite often, but not on any regular schedule. I recently redesigned the home page of my business website by adding a PHP News script (used to share client and business news) and a featured client spotlight that changes every few weeks, both of which give me a purpose for updating.

I like to keep the home page changing to provide interest and keep people coming back. Both of these features do that for me.
